Fumonisin toxicity in turkey poults.

Abstract

The effects of dietary fumonisin B1 were evaluated in young turkey poults. The experimental design consisted of 3 treatments, with 24 female turkey poults allotted randomly per treatment. Day-old poults were fed diets containing 0 mg (feed control), 100 mg, and 200 mg fumonisin B1/kg feed for 21 days. Body weight gains and efficiency of feed conversion decreased linearly with increasing dietary fumonisin. Liver, kidney, and pancreas weights increased linearly with increasing dietary fumonisin, and spleen and heart weights decreased. Serum aspartate aminotransferase levels increased with increasing dietary fumonisin, and serum cholesterol; alkaline phosphatase, mean cell volume, and mean cell hemoglobin all decreased. Biliary hyperplasia, hypertrophy of Kupffer's cells, thymic cortical atrophy, and moderate widening of the proliferating and degenerating hypertrophied zones of tibial physes were present in poults fed diets containing fumonisin B1. Results indicate that fumonisin B1, from Fusarium moniliforme culture material, is toxic in young poults, and the poult appears to be more sensitive to fumonisin than the broiler chick.

摘要

研究评估了日粮中伏马菌素B1对小火鸡的影响。实验设计包括3种处理,每种处理随机分配24只雌性小火鸡。1日龄小火鸡被饲喂含0毫克(饲料对照)、100毫克和200毫克伏马菌素B1/千克饲料的日粮,持续21天。随着日粮中伏马菌素含量的增加,体重增加和饲料转化率呈线性下降。肝脏、肾脏和胰腺重量随着日粮中伏马菌素含量的增加呈线性增加,而脾脏和心脏重量下降。血清天冬氨酸转氨酶水平随着日粮中伏马菌素含量的增加而升高,血清胆固醇、碱性磷酸酶、平均细胞体积和平均细胞血红蛋白均下降。饲喂含伏马菌素B1日粮的小火鸡出现胆管增生、库普弗细胞肥大、胸腺皮质萎缩以及胫骨生长板增殖和退变肥大区域中度增宽。结果表明,来自串珠镰刀菌培养物的伏马菌素B1对小火鸡有毒,且小火鸡似乎比肉鸡对伏马菌素更敏感。
